Easter flowers cardDescriptionA single fold card has a square of dark green card then a square of white card mounted on the front. A Happy Easter flower design is stamped on the white card in embossed gold. Glitter glue and colored pens add decorative touches. Materials used
MethodFold the sheet of mottled green card in half to create a greetings card 116mm wide x 90mm high (4.5 ins x 3.5 ins). Add groups of six fine random spots to the front of the card with a green felt tip pen. Mount the piece of green card on the greeting card front with adhesive. Stamp the Happy Easter bouquet design on a piece of white card using a gold embossing inkpad. Sprinkle with gold embossing powder and emboss with a heat tool. Colour the design with felt pens. Outline the white card with gold glitter glue. Mount the white card on the dark green card using adhesive.
